PLANNING A Show. Here is how we plan an art show. 1st step is the “Call For Artists” post. When 20 artists commit to that show then we decide the show’s date.
-
Depending on the size of your art we should be able to display 1-3 pieces per artist. Max size that can be hung is 6’ x 10’ can be hung (Horizontal). Smaller pieces of art are welcome. However, If your art is small it must be placed in a frame that is sized a 10"x12" or larger.
-
There are 3 safe & secured showcases available for 3D art. During the show's opening night the 3D will be on display in the gallery's main space.
-
READY TO BE HUNG: Your art work has to have a wire on the back. (Unless it is 3D and will be placed in one the display cases. No other forms of attaching art to the will work (D-Rings, Alligator hooks, sticky tape... will not work and cannot be used). A $10 fee per piece shall be charged if we have to make the art ready to be hung.

Drop Off Dates. Typically, the Tuesday prior to a show's opening will be the only drop off day. Everyone will drop off, stay and help hang the show on the If you cannot do this on that date, you can schedule another date prior to the show, but you will have to pay $10 for not helping to hang the show. We did a test of this process for the Anniversary Art Show and it went really well. The show's art was hung quickly. There was great camaraderie and coordination between the artists. It was fun and successful and we will continue to do this moving forward

Deadlines
The deadline to submit your art and send in your contact is 15 days prior the show's opening date.
The deadline to drop off your art is the Tuesday before the show's opening date (Art Hanging date). The artist will also help hang the show on this evening starting at 6pm. If an artist cannot help hang the show, the artist can drop off the art on any date prior to the Art Hanging date. There is a fee for not helping hang. Read the contract.
2
Images
When you send an image or a photo, please use these guidelines:
1. We highly suggest that you add a watermark layer to your image. This image might be used for marketing. Doing so will protect your art from pirates.
2. The image should be saved at 150 DPI to 300 DPI and up to 1MB. (Images for Art Apparel have different standards)
